Block

#18,483,348
Block Number
18,483,348 @ 05/10/2024, 17:15:10
Status
Finalized
ID
0x011a089461f095d94e17d190a3e79840d22d1eb23497a2b4b6b8f263921516d0
Transactions
Gas Used
1253436/39999962 (3.13% Used)
Total Score
1,801,529,979 (+96)
Rewards
4.28 VTHO